Output 1c8ea3dec305aca8ab7554a0c1dc8f1810844c21ee644ac47614423c62d64ebf:2

value
176498965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f03995369a48bdd45828c094cf922c350463d0f OP_EQUAL
address
34X1BYmJcb5sd7uiwcdYhhXQpgGYSyAUxU
transaction
1c8ea3dec305aca8ab7554a0c1dc8f1810844c21ee644ac47614423c62d64ebf
spent
true